1. Prepare the soilWhen planting dahlias, first choose soil with uniform texture and good drainage as the culture tray. Note that it is best to disinfect the soil in advance. 2. SowingThen sow the seeds, cover them with a thin layer of fine soil, water them thoroughly to keep the soil moist, and be careful to keep it at a suitable temperature and not let it freeze. After about a week, sprouts will appear. After sprouting, be careful to avoid direct sunlight. 3. NotesDahlia is a plant that likes fertilizer. It needs sufficient fertilizer supply to grow. When the conditions are not met, the flowers will be affected to a certain extent. It likes a cooler climate environment, about 10 to 25 degrees Celsius is just right. Especially in the hot summer weather, you can control the temperature by sprinkling water all around. |
